Storm light at Cranbrook A pair of Canadian Pacific SD40-2s switch the small yard at Cranbrook, British Columbia, at the end of a rainy July 14, 2011. The historic covered water tank still survives (although moved from its original location) as part of the Cranbrook Railroad Museum.
